The Third Bank of the River (Portuguese: A Terceira Margem do Rio) is a 1994 Brazilian drama film directed by Nelson Pereira dos Santos. It is based on the short stories "A Menina de Lá", "Os Irmãos Dagobé", "Fatalidade", "Seqüência", and "A Terceira Margem do Rio" by João Guimarães Rosa compiled into the book Primeiras Estórias.[1] It was entered into the 44th Berlin International Film Festival.[2]
